Good afternoon, in this file a PWM converter is connected to a grid. My question is whether it is necessary or not to perform a load flow before simulating this file.
If not could you please suggest other cases where a previous load flow is required to set the values of the blocks? Thanks in advance!

due to the power electronics involved and how they are modelled in this model, the load flow option would not work. Instead, this model was run to steady state, and those states were saved and then put in as initial conditions.
Here are some models that use load flow. Unfortunately, if your main goal is the power electronics simulation, this type of work flow won't be useful for you.
